DUBAI, United Arab Emirates (AP) — Chinese leader Xi Jinping arrived in Saudi Arabia on Wednesday to attend meetings with oil-rich Gulf Arab nations crucial to his country's energy supplies as Beijing tries to revive an economy battered by its strict coronavirus measures.